Hjem Udvikling Hvad er en kodegenerator? - definition fra techopedia

Hvad er en kodegenerator? - definition fra techopedia

Indholdsfortegnelse:

Anonim

Definition - Hvad betyder kodegenerator?

En kodegenerator er et værktøj eller en ressource, der genererer en bestemt slags kode eller computerprogrammeringssprog. Dette har mange specifikke betydninger i IT-verdenen, mange af dem er relateret til de undertiden komplekse processer med at konvertere menneskelig programmeringssyntaks til det maskinsprog, der kan læses af et computersystem.

Techopedia forklarer kodegenerator

En af de mest almindelige og konventionelle anvendelser af udtrykket "kodegenerator" er at beskrive dele af compilersystemerne, der behandler moderne computerprogrammeringssprog. IT-fagfolk kalder muligvis den del af en compiler, der konverterer en repræsentation af kildekoden til maskinkode, en "kodegenerator." De kan også henvise til en kodegenereringsfase, hvor kompilatoren bruger ting som valg af instruktion, instruktionsplanlægning og registerfordeling til analysere og håndtere kodeindgange til output.

En anden almindelig brug af udtrykket "kodegenerator" involverer andre ressourcer eller værktøjer, der hjælper med at vise specifikke slags koder. For eksempel kan nogle hjemmelavede eller open source-kodegeneratorer generere klasser og metoder til lettere eller mere praktisk computerprogrammering. Denne type ressource kan også kaldes en komponentgenerator.

Ud over ovenstående anvendelser kan folk muligvis bruge udtrykket “kodegenerator” til at tale om et system, der genererer specifikke proprietære typer kodede meddelelser. Et interessant eksempel er Geek-koden, et alfanumerisk system, som selvbeskrevne “geeks” bruger til at kommunikere med hinanden om en række identifikatorer. Denne kode, der bliver brugt på forskellige platforme og i forskellige formater, kan genereres af et kodegenereringsværktøj, der konverterer tekst til nørdekode.

Hvad er en kodegenerator? - definition fra techopedia